Description
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in demos/demo.mysqli.php in getID3 1.X and v2.0.0-beta all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the showtagfiles parameter.
Metrics
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:C/C:L/I:L/A:N

Affected Software
| Vendor | Product | Versions | Update |
|---|---|---|---|
| Getid3 | Getid3 | >= 1.9.0, < 2.0.0 | — |
| Getid3 | Getid3 | 2.0.0 | Beta |
